here i am to the rescue! lol Heres my review of one of my favorite model cars; done up in C&D Style!
The Good: Its a Camaro. And its an SS. Plus its affordable, mediocore detail The Bad:Alot of things are wrong with this car. A: The car comes with manual window cranks. Um, i dont belive this was an option for 2002. I think its because it sharers parts with Monogram's 97 (?) Pontiac Forumula. Getting the throttle body to hook up with the airbag can be a tricky bitch. Another inaccurate thing would be the body line, which Honoturtle previously mentioned. And, with this kit, the dashboard has the Delco sterio installed. But it comes with the steering wheel radio controls. The steering wheel radio controlls were equipped if only the car had the Monsoon system. The front suspension is..wiggly, because the top shock/springs dont hit the upper fender, resulting in a bit of a camber. Oh yeah, dont folly the directions/box art. In the box art car it shows the reverse lights on bottom and blinkers on top. That is wrong. Do the opposite. Underhood has been kept to a bare minimal. Also, dont get upset if you get glue on the headlights. Its basically impossible not to. And you might brake the front facia off trying to get the chassis to fit in there. The Verdict: If you really want a good simple LS1 SS, i suggest getting AMT's Z28, and put the SS Hood, spoiler and LS1Nose on it. Heres some pics..
